Howard Stern is facing backlash over a resurfaced interview in which he asked Sofía Vergara to breastfeed him.
Stern kicked off the 2003 sit-down on his radio show by complimenting her chest, according to a video shared on Reddit.
“Now, you’ve taken off your coat. You do have a big chest, and I’m going to tell you something — don’t touch it,” Stern told the actress after she took off her jacket to reveal her black T-shirt underneath.
“I like it,” he added, causing Vergara to smile awkwardly and muster a polite, “Thank you very much.”
Despite her noticeable discomfort, Stern continued to comment on her body.
“Believe me, there is no greater man on this planet than me, and if I tell you your chest is attractive, you keep it,” he demanded.
Vergara agreed, telling him in almost a whisper, “OK, I’ll never touch it.”
He then claimed that the “Modern Family” star’s mother gave her “the best advice,” which is, “Don’t touch those boobs.”
Vergara tried to laugh off the exchange before Stern jumped in to ask if she breastfed her son, Manolo. The “Griselda” star gave birth to her son when she was just 19.
When she confirmed that she had breastfed Manolo, now 33, Stern creepily replied, “Oh, that must’ve been unbelievable.”
“That wasn’t unbelievable — I was like 19,” Vergara fired back.
Stern joked that there must have been “so much milk,” prompting Vergara to exclaim that there’s “no respect here.”
“Oh, come on. I’m respecting you all over the place,” he said, before weirdly stating, “That kid must’ve been fat from eating all that milk. I would love to feed from you.”
“If you don’t want to go out with me, then at least let me feed from your chest,” he pressed.
Vergara swiftly shut him down, telling him, “But I’m not pregnant now,” to which Stern joked, “Oh, that can be arranged.”

It seems that Vergara took the whole thing in stride, however, as she returned to his radio show for another interview in 2015 while promoting her film, “Hot Pursuit.”
Page Six has reached out to reps for Stern, 71, and Vergara, 54, for comment.
The cringeworthy conversation with Vergara resurfaced after reports swirled that Stern’s SiriusXM show is in trouble as it approaches the end of its $500 million contract.
However, sources claimed this week that Stern’s team was behind the gossip in an attempt to up his relevancy.
